Re: Keep any pennies you find
Anything you read from money morning you can wipe your memory straight after reading it!, I used to read it but they talk to much crap for me....copper prices are not at $3.50kg yet, 3 years ago we we getting $8.00 from local scrap yards per kg for copper, at those prices copper was being stolen from all sorts of places and that alone forced copper prices down. With the abundance of copper and the applications that copper is used we are not going to see any significant rise in prices that will stagger us any time soon.
Unless you buy mega $$ of copper now you may not see anything after the capital gains hits you from a quick turn around.
